Release checklist — telemetry compression. Verify the Hollowpine agent compresses payloads with the zstd path, not the legacy gzip fallback. Steps: flip the compression flag in staging, confirm median payload drops below 8 KB, and check the ingest tier decodes without errors for 30 minutes. Watch CPU on the collector; if it climbs past 70%, lower the compression level one notch. Do not ship if decode errors exceed 0.1%. Record the validated agent build token directly under this item before closing the checklist.

pipeline stamp: htk31_f769b577b3028a4e9958e5bb8d1259a

Handover: Spoolhopper Service

Hey — Spoolhopper is mostly stable now. The retry queue occasionally hoards jobs when a printer node flaps; just bounce the dispatcher and it clears. Don't touch the legacy PCL path, it's load-bearing. Metrics, known quirks, and the restart checklist are all kept on the page below.

runbook for kahof-yaweg: https://superset.tolvaqdyn.test/settings/repo/projects/display/68a0f19bdd1535be

## Break-glass: Paritywick rate checker

On-call: if the Paritywick crawler floods partner hotel sites or the comparison cache corrupts, kill it via the break-glass console, not by stopping pods. The console halts crawls cleanly and freezes cached rates. Normal auth won't work during an incident lockout; the console will prompt you directly for the recovery passphrase, which is:

vault phrase of kafog-kahif = holdor-rusir-praox